Third parties, criminal proceedings and access to the civil courts – Article by Mark Warwick KC

Good news for those who are not Defendants, but get caught up in Crown Court proceedings.  Contrary to the CPS arguments, the CA has now decided that POCA does not provide a complete and exhaustive code for the resolution of disputed property rights which may arise between the CPS and a third party.  Ahmet v Tatum & CPS [2024] EWCA Civ 255 establishes that the third party may still access the civil courts, even where property is the subject of criminal proceedings.
